#19b71e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#19b71e is composed of 9.8% red, 71.8% green and 11.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 86.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 83.6% yellow and 28.2% black. It has a hue angle of 121.9 degrees, a saturation of 76% and a lightness of 40.8%. #19b71e color hex could be obtained by blending #32ff3c with #006f00. Closest websafe color is: #00cc33.

#19b71e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#19b71e has RGB values of R:25, G:183, B:30 and CMYK values of C:0.86, M:0, Y:0.84, K:0.28. Its decimal value is 1685278.

Hex triplet 19b71e #19b71e
RGB Decimal 25, 183, 30 rgb(25,183,30)
RGB Percent 9.8, 71.8, 11.8 rgb(9.8%,71.8%,11.8%)
CMYK 86, 0, 84, 28
HSL 121.9°, 76, 40.8 hsl(121.9,76%,40.8%)
HSV (or HSB) 121.9°, 86.3, 71.8
Web Safe 00cc33 #00cc33
CIE-LAB 65.094, -64.727, 60.092
XYZ 17.568, 34.165, 6.897
xyY 0.3, 0.583, 34.165
CIE-LCH 65.094, 88.321, 137.127
CIE-LUV 65.094, -59.444, 76.145
Hunter-Lab 58.451, -48.641, 33.92
Binary 00011001, 10110111, 00011110

Shades and Tints of #19b71e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010a02 is the darkest color, while #f8fef8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#19b71e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#616f61 is the less saturated color, while #01cf08 is the most saturated one.
